Biological Activity: Basic fibroblast growth factor (FGF-BASIC)(E. coli), also known as FGF-2, is a multipotent cytokine and one of the prototype members of the heparin-binding FGF family. Like other MEMBERS of the FGF family, alkaline FGF has a β trilobular structure. In vivo, BASIC fibroblast factor is produced by a variety of cells, including myocardial microbiota, fibroblasts, and vascular cells. BFGF regulates a variety of processes, including cell proliferation, differentiation, survival, adhesion, motility, apoptosis, limb formation, and wound healing.

Conversion of different model animals based on BSA (PMID: 27057123)
Species Mouse Rat Rabbit Guinea pig Hamster Dog
Weight (kg) 0.02 0.15 1.8 0.4 0.08 10
Body Surface Area (m2) 0.007 0.025 0.15 0.05 0.02 0.5
Km factor 3 6 12 8 5 20
Animal A (mg/kg) = Animal B (mg/kg) multiplied by  Animal B Km
Animal A Km

For example, to modify the dose of Compound A used for a mouse (20 mg/kg) to a dose based on the BSA for a rat, multiply 20 mg/kg by the Km factor for a mouse and then divide by the Km factor for a rat. This calculation results in a rat equivalent dose for Compound A of 10 mg/kg.

DPP4/CD26 is a signal-anchor for type II membrane protein that belongs to the peptidase S9B family. DPP4/CD26 acts as a positive regulator of T-cell coactivation, by binding at least ADA, CAV1, IGF2R, and PTPRC. It’s binding to CAV1 and CARD11 induces T-cell proliferation and NF-kappa-B activation in a T-cell receptor/CD3-dependent manner.

USP14 belongs to the ubiquitin-specific processing (USP) family which is a deubiquitinating enzyme (DUB) with His and Cys domains. USP14 acts also as a physiological inhibitor of endoplasmic reticulum-associated degradation (ERAD) under the non-stressed condition by inhibiting the degradation of unfolded endoplasmic reticulum proteins via interaction with ERN1.

Epithelial Cell Adhesion Molecule (EpCAM) is a signal type I transmembrane glycoprotein. EpCAM plays a role in embryonic stem cells proliferation and differentiation; it up-regulates the expression of FABP5, MYC and Cyclin A and Cyclin E. It is highly and selectively expressed by undifferentiated embryonic stem cells.
